20 meter club

The 20 meter club was founded on April 28, 1983, at Eerikkilä Sports Academy with six men being selected as members.

In its fall meeting, the club awards the "Kultapoju" or Golden Boy to a promising shot putter.

The last recipient to date was Niko Hauhia, who also received a EUR 500 stipend for training.

The club also awards training grants in order to promote and help athletes develop.
